"The Atlantic Monthly, Volume 18, No. 107, September, 1866" by Various is a magazine that showcases diverse writings relevant to the era in which in was written. The work contains a compilation of essays and stories that explore the social, political, and cultural landscape of the time. The early parts of the magazine relate personal experiences such as the story of Nancy, a soldier's wife, and Jenny, a little girl writing letters to her father, capturing the challenges and emotions of individuals and families during wartime; this creates a tapestry of voices reflecting the human condition amid significant historical events, especially the effect of war.
